2x -4y= 28
⇒ -4y= 28 -2x
⇒ y= (28 -2x)/ (-4)
⇒ y= 28/(-4) -(2x)/ (-4)
⇒ y= -7 + 1/2x
The final answer is y= -7 + 1/2x~
